The VT505FQ from Maxim Integrated is a robust, high-performance voltage transceiver designed for automotive and industrial applications. This versatile device is engineered to handle the rigorous demands of high-speed data communication while providing reliable operation under extreme conditions.
Key Features
- Dual-Channel Interface: The VT505FQ offers a dual-channel interface, allowing for efficient communication and data transfer between devices.
- Wide Voltage Range: It operates over a broad voltage range, accommodating various power supply requirements and ensuring compatibility with a range of automotive and industrial equipment.
- High-Speed Operation: Designed for high-speed operation, this transceiver is capable of handling the fast data rates required by modern communication protocols.
- Thermal Protection: The device includes thermal protection features to safeguard against overheating, ensuring long-term reliability and performance.
- Robust ESD Protection: Enhanced electrostatic discharge (ESD) protection is built-in, providing resilience against the common electrical hazards found in automotive and industrial environments.
- Low Power Consumption: The VT505FQ is optimized for low power consumption, making it an energy-efficient choice for systems where power conservation is critical.

Technical Specifications
Some of the technical specifications for the VT505FQ include:
- Supply Voltage: 4.5V to 5.5V
- Operating Temperature Range: -40°C to +125°C
- Package: 14-TSSOP
